Of Turbo and Lovers

Year: 1986 Song: "Turbo Lover" by Judas Priest So "Turbo Lover" is my favorite Judas Priest song because who among us can resist a three-verse extended metaphor that likens sexual intercourse to motorcycle riding. For three verses. Sometimes a beloved song does not a compelling video make, though. Fortunately, that is so not the case here. Compelling, … Continue reading Of Turbo and Lovers